talktofrank.com
Frank is an excellent online resource that provides reliable information about substances. It's a valuable platform for anyone who wants to learn more about the impact of drugs and how to avoid harm.
People can find information on read more a wide range of drugs, as well as advice on seeking support. Frank is also a helpful tool for educators who need information about drug use and its effects.
- Frank offers a comprehensive database of facts about drugs
- Users can also get help resources
- Frank is a free platform that is available 24/7
